AI Workflow for E-commerce Product Listings at Scale
The E-commerce Content Challenge
E-commerce businesses with hundreds or thousands of products face a massive content challenge: each product needs a unique, compelling description, optimized title, SEO-friendly metadata, and high-quality images. Writing these manually is prohibitively expensive and slow. AI workflows solve this by generating, optimizing, and managing product content at scale while maintaining quality and brand consistency.
Step 1: Product Data Preparation
Start by organizing your product data in a structured format. Create a spreadsheet or database with columns for product name, category, key features (3-5 per product), materials, dimensions, target audience, use cases, and any unique selling points. This structured data becomes the input for AI content generation. The quality of your input data directly determines the quality of AI output.
Step 2: AI Description Generation
Tools: ChatGPT API, Claude API, Jasper
Use AI to generate product descriptions from your structured data. Create a prompt template that specifies your brand voice, target length (150-300 words for standard products, 500+ for premium items), and formatting requirements. Process products in batches using the API for efficiency.
Example prompt structure: “Write a product description for [product name] in the [category] category. Key features: [features]. Target audience: [audience]. Brand voice: [professional/casual/luxury]. Include a compelling opening line, feature highlights with benefits, and a clear call to action. Length: 200 words.”
Generate 2-3 variations per product and select the best one, or have AI combine the strongest elements from multiple versions. This produces better results than single-generation approaches.
Step 3: SEO Optimization
Optimize each listing for search engines. Use AI to generate SEO titles (under 60 characters) that include the primary keyword naturally. Create meta descriptions (under 160 characters) with the target keyword and a compelling reason to click. Generate bullet-point feature lists optimized for both search and readability.
Research keywords per product category using Semrush or Ahrefs. Integrate these keywords into product titles, descriptions, and tags. AI can map keywords to products based on category and features automatically.
Step 4: AI Image Enhancement
Tools: Canva AI, Midjourney, PhotoRoom
Enhance product images at scale. Use PhotoRoom or Canva AI to remove backgrounds, create consistent white-background product photos, and generate lifestyle context images. For products without professional photography, use AI to create mockups and styled product shots. Consistent visual presentation across your catalog improves trust and conversion rates.
Step 5: Bulk Upload and Quality Control
Before uploading to your e-commerce platform, run quality checks. Use AI to review all descriptions for accuracy, consistency, and brand voice compliance. Check for duplicate content across similar products. Verify that SEO elements are properly formatted. Bulk upload to Shopify, WooCommerce, Amazon, or your platform using CSV import or API integration.
Step 6: A/B Testing and Optimization
After publishing, A/B test different description styles, title formats, and image types to identify what drives the most conversions. Use ChatGPT to analyze sales data and identify patterns: which description elements correlate with higher conversion rates. Continuously optimize your highest-traffic listings based on performance data.
Scaling the Workflow
| Catalog Size | Without AI | With AI |
|---|---|---|
| 100 products | 2-3 weeks | 2-3 days |
| 1,000 products | 2-3 months | 1-2 weeks |
| 10,000 products | 6-12 months | 4-6 weeks |
ChatGPT or Claude API for descriptions | Semrush for SEO | Canva AI or PhotoRoom for images | Copy.ai for ad copy
Find the Perfect AI Tool for Your Needs
Compare pricing, features, and reviews of 50+ AI tools
Browse All AI Tools →Get Weekly AI Tool Updates
Join 1,000+ professionals. Free AI tools cheatsheet included.